Output d39275ba15d67bc3f91ec89ca44105959cd8180ad5c5561d19db85c15476cc3a:2

value
27970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ae270f6e48a8cda5fd45ab4ed1e446345b233847 OP_EQUAL
address
3HZrHssJp8SGQGbNCrp8iw6Ksgu4p7nzMK
transaction
d39275ba15d67bc3f91ec89ca44105959cd8180ad5c5561d19db85c15476cc3a
spent
true